uv tool install . --no-cache --reinstall| Variable | Required | Description |
|---|---|---|
PORTAINER_URL |
Yes* | Portainer base URL (can also use -u flag) |
PORTAINER_ACCESS_TOKEN |
Yes | Portainer API key |
S3_ACCESS_KEY |
For S3 | S3 access key |
S3_SECRET_KEY |
For S3 | S3 secret key |
S3_ENDPOINT |
For S3 | S3/MinIO endpoint URL |
DUPLICATI_PASSPHRASE |
No | Backup encryption passphrase |
* Required for docker commands. Can be provided via -u flag instead.

# Stack deployment (Swarm-only)
ptctools docker stack deploy -n mystack -f compose.yaml
# Secret management (Swarm-only)
echo "postgresql://user:pass@db:5432/mydb" | ptctools docker secret create db_dsn
ptctools docker secret create -f /path/to/secret.txt my_secret
ptctools docker secret create -v "secret-value" my_secret
# Config management (Swarm-only)
ptctools docker config set -n my-config -d "config content"
ptctools docker config set -n nginx.conf -f ./nginx.conf
ptctools docker config set -n my-config -d "new content" --force
ptctools docker config list
ptctools docker config get -n my-config
ptctools docker config delete -n my-config
# Volume backup/restore (uses Duplicati)
ptctools docker volume backup -v vol1,vol2 -o s3://mybucket
ptctools docker volume restore -i s3://mybucket/vol1 # volume name derived from URI path
ptctools docker volume restore -v vol1 -i s3://mybucket/vol1 # explicit volume name
# Volume copy (raw copy using mc/busybox)
ptctools docker volume cp source dest # volume to volume
ptctools docker volume cp s3://mybucket/path dest # S3 to volume
ptctools docker volume cp source s3://mybucket/path # volume to S3
# Volume management
ptctools docker volume rm myvolume # remove volume (with confirmation)
ptctools docker volume rm -y myvolume # remove without confirmation
ptctools docker volume rename old_name new_name # rename volume (copy + delete)
# Database backup/restore (uses minio/mc for S3)
ptctools docker db backup -c container_id -v db_data \
--db-user postgres --db-name mydb -o backup.sql.gz
ptctools docker db backup -c container_id -v db_data \
--db-user postgres --db-name mydb -o s3://mybucket/backups/db.sql.gz
ptctools docker db restore -c container_id -v db_data \
--db-user postgres --db-name mydb -i backup.sql.gz
ptctools docker db restore -c container_id -v db_data \
--db-user postgres --db-name mydb -i s3://mybucket/backups/db.sql.gz
# Override PORTAINER_URL with -u flag
ptctools docker secret create -u https://other.portainer.com -f dsn.txt my_secret
# Utils - local Duplicati operations (no Portainer needed)
ptctools utils backup --input ./data --output s3://backups/mydata
ptctools utils restore --input s3://backups/mydata --output ./restored

Deploy or update a Docker Swarm stack in Portainer.
Create a Docker Swarm secret. Value can be provided via stdin, file, or command-line argument.
Manage Docker Swarm configs via Portainer API.
- backup: Backup multiple Docker volumes (comma-separated) to S3 using Duplicati container.
- restore: Restore a single Docker volume from S3. Volume name can be specified via
--volumeor derived from the input URI path.
Copy data between volumes and S3 (raw file copy).
- volume to volume: Uses
busyboxwithcp -a - S3 to volume: Uses
minio/mcto download files - volume to S3: Uses
minio/mcto upload files
Remove a Docker volume. Use -y to skip confirmation, -f to force removal.
Rename a volume by copying data to a new volume and deleting the original.
Backup/restore PostgreSQL database. Supports both local files and S3 URIs.
- Uses
pg_dump/psqlfor database operations - Uses
minio/mccontainer for S3 transfers
Local backup/restore operations using Duplicati CLI (docker or local). Does not require Portainer.
